Single jacketed with non-asbestos or heat resistant fiber and no top
washer. Protects both edges of filler material. For relatively narrow applications. |
| #20 |
 |
Double jacketed with non-asbestos or heat resistant filler and top washer.
Provides maximum filler protection. Most popular style for heat exchangers. |

French type - one piece metal jacket with filler. For narrow applications
where positive, metal gasket face is required across full width. |
| #23 |
 |
French type - two piece metal gasket with filler. For irregular or wide
shapes not needing filler material protection or extra flange support at outer edge. |

Inverted French type - one piece metal jacket and non-asbestos or heat
resistant filler fully enclosed in single metal shell overlapped on one face. For narrow
width application. |
| #26 |
 |
Overlapping metal jacket. Non-asbestos or heat resistant filler fully
enclosed in single metal shell overlapped on one face. For narrow width application. |

Concentric grooved profile gasket with style 14 as filler. Used where
conditions require a profile type gasket and complete flange protection. |
| #15 |
 |
Double jacketed profile gasket with Style 14 as filler. Used where
conditions require a profile type gasket and complete flange protection. |
| #16 |
 |
Single jacketed profile gasket with Style 14 as filler. Allows flange
protection on one face. Jacket material may be different than filler material. |
| #17 |
 |
Serrated metal with machined concentric ribs. Used where wide, all metal
gaskets with reduced contact areas are required. |
| #100 |
 |
Plain single sheet corrugated gasket for low pressure seals on smooth
flanges with low bolt pressures. Low cost, light weight & more resilient than flat
solid gaskets. |
| #200 |
 |
Non-asbestos or heat resistant filler cemented on grooves of Style 100.
Allows positive seal on rough or uneven flange surfaces. |

Double jacketed corrugated with non-asbestos or heat resistant filler.
Corrugated jacket results in added resilience. |

Double jacketed corrugated with Style 100 filler. The metal corrugated
filler offers a greater resistance to temperature change problems. |

Solid gasket-round cross section. Formed from round cross-section wire.
Normally installed in narrow machined flanges used in low pressure and low bolt load
application. |

Lens gasket-solid metal-machined-a line contact seal for high-pressure
piping systems. |
| #34 |
 |
Delta-solid metal-machined-gasket that inserts into triangular groove . A
pressure vessel or valve bonnet gasket used in pressure range of 5,000 psi and higher. |
| #35 |
 |
Solid metal for smooth flange face and high bolt load. Great strength,
good heat conductivity and resistance to temperature, corrosion and pressure. Many sizes
& shapes -all metals and thicknesses. |
